About This Book

Jean-Marie spoke softly. "We were man and wife once, Sister, and we were so very happy until I died giving birth. Poor Philippe was so foolish. He walked into the sea to join me, leaving our child an orphan." Sister Hillaire shivered and crossed herself quickly. What had come over the child? Jean-Marie had suddenly looked so adult and spoke of marriage, childbirth, and suicide, things that were beyond her comprehension. What would a child of eight, living always at St. Yves Orphan Home know of things like that?
